Ways to get around Arvada
Walking
Arvada offers a mix of walkable areas, particularly in its historic Olde Town district, where pedestrian-friendly streets and compact design make it easy to explore on foot. However, other parts of the city may be less accessible due to suburban layouts and distances between destinations. Sidewalks and crossings are present in many areas, but infrastructure varies, and some neighborhoods may prioritize car travel. Weather conditions, such as snow in winter, can also impact walkability. Overall, walking can be a convenient option in certain parts of Arvada, but it may not always be the most practical choice depending on location and conditions.
Biking
Cycling in Arvada is supported by a network of bike lanes and trails that make it a practical way to get around. The city features popular routes like the Ralston Creek Trail and Van Bibber Creek Trail, which provide scenic and accessible pathways for cyclists. Many areas are connected by dedicated bike lanes, allowing for safer travel. However, the suitability of biking depends on the distance to your destination and the terrain, as some routes may include inclines. The city’s infrastructure supports cycling as a convenient option for commuting or recreation.

Public Transit
Public transit in Arvada is primarily provided through the Regional Transportation District (RTD), which includes commuter rail and bus services. The G Line commuter rail connects Arvada to Denver and other nearby areas, with stations such as Olde Town Arvada providing convenient access. RTD buses also serve the city, offering routes to various destinations. Public transit can be a practical choice for getting around, especially for those traveling to well-connected areas. However, the ease of access may vary depending on the specific location, and walking or additional transit may be required to reach certain spots.
Train
Train transportation in Arvada is available through the G Line commuter rail, which connects the city to Denver Union Station. The train provides a convenient option for reaching destinations in the Denver metro area. With three commuter rail stations in Arvada, including one in Olde Town, access to the train is straightforward for many residents and visitors. Trains typically run on a regular schedule, making them a reliable choice for travel. However, the train routes are limited to specific areas, so it may not cover all destinations within Arvada itself.
